Second round of tuition hikes likely at UC and Cal State systems
Student leaders expressed disappointment about their soaring tuition and said that Sacramento is putting the brunt of the state’s budget problems on them. A decade of increases has more than tripled tuition to about $11,000 a year at UC and $4,884 at Cal State, not including room, board and other fees. "Ultimately, this again represents the ongoing disinvestment in higher education in California," said Christopher Chavez, outgoing president of the Cal State Student Assn. "What it comes down to is that students are expected to pay more and to get less." … At UC, the $650-million reduction represents a 21% drop in state funds.
